Enabling versioning in Swift publication
DX Core publishing versions pages by default in the publishing process. To enable versioning for content within the Assets app and other content applications when using Swift publication, each respective application needs configuration.
Configuring content apps
To configure content applications for versioning with Swift publication, follow the steps illustrated using the Personas app below.

Configuring the DAM app
The DAM app’s versioning configuration for Swift publication mirrors that of other content apps. You should decorate publishing, deletion, and restore actions for Swift publication.
-
The
catalog
property must be set toexternal
. -
The
bulk
property isn’t supported and must be set tofalse
.
